> The tag format sort of becomes fixed ABI as soon as user space is able
> to run "cat /sys/class/net/eth0/dsa/tagging", see "yt921x", and record
> it to a pcap file. Unless the EtherType bears some other meaning rather
> than being a fixed value, then if you change it later to some other
> value than 0x9988, you'd better also change the protocol name to
> distinguish it from "yt921x".
>

"EtherType" here does not necessarily become EtherType; better to
think it is a key to enable port control over the switch. It could be
a dynamic random value as long as everyone gets the same value all
over the kernel, see the setup process of the switch driver. Ideally
only the remaining content of the tag should become the ABI (and is
actually enforced by the switch), but making a dynamic "EtherType" is
clearly a worse idea so I don't know how to clarify the fact...

> Also, you can _not_ use yt921x_priv :: tag_eth_p, because doing so would
> assume that typeof(ds->priv) == struct yt921x_priv. In principle we
> would like to be able to run the tagging protocols on the dsa_loop
> driver as well, which can be attached to any network interface. Very
> few, if any, tagging protocol drivers don't work on dsa_loop.

> This is generally used for integrated DSA switches, for lossless
> backpressure during CPU transmission, where the conduit interface driver
> is known, and has set up its queues in a special way, as a result of the
> fact that it is attached to a known DSA switch (made by the same vendor).
> What do you need it for, in a discrete MDIO-controlled switch?
